400-680-8581
欢迎访问:路由通
中国IT知识门户
位置:路由通 > 资讯中心 > excel > 文章详情

excel中的col是什么意思

作者:路由通
|
42人看过
发布时间:2026-04-13 23:23:57
标签:
在微软的表格处理软件中,COL(列)是一个核心概念,它不仅是数据存储的基本单位,更是众多函数与公式运作的基石。本文将深入解析COL函数及其相关功能,从基础定义到高级应用,涵盖相对引用、范围处理、数组公式结合以及常见错误排查。无论您是初学者还是希望提升效率的进阶用户,都能在此找到关于“列”的全面、实用指南。
excel中的col是什么意思

       在日常使用微软的表格处理软件时,我们频繁地与行和列打交道。如果说行构成了数据记录的纵向序列,那么列就是定义数据属性的横向分类。而“COL”这个概念,正是“列”这一核心元素的直接体现。它不仅仅是一个简单的界面标识,更是一系列强大功能背后的逻辑基础。理解“COL”的深层含义,能够帮助我们摆脱机械化的操作,真正掌握数据处理的精髓。

       一、 基础认知:COL究竟是什么?

       在表格的语境中,“COL”是“Column”(列)的缩写。最直观的表现就是工作表顶部按字母顺序排列的列标,从A、B、C一直向后延伸。每一列都是一个垂直的数据单元,用于存放同一类型的信息,例如“姓名列”、“日期列”或“金额列”。这是数据得以结构化存储和清晰呈现的根本。除了这个视觉标识,软件更将“列”抽象为一个重要的引用概念,并内置于其函数体系之中,这便是接下来要详细探讨的COL函数及其家族。

       二、 核心函数:COLUMN函数的深度解析

       COLUMN函数是直接返回指定单元格列号的工具。其语法非常简单:`=COLUMN([reference])`。如果省略参数,函数将返回公式所在单元格的列号。例如,在C列的任何单元格中输入`=COLUMN()`,结果都是数字3,因为C是第3列。如果参数是某个单元格引用,如`=COLUMN(F5)`,则返回F列的列号,即数字6。这个函数是许多动态公式的起点,它让公式能够“感知”自身或目标在表格中的横向位置。

       三、 动态引用的灵魂:相对性的妙用

       COLUMN函数最强大的特性之一是其引用方式带来的动态效果。当配合相对引用并横向填充公式时,它能生成连续变化的序列。假设在A1单元格输入公式`=COLUMN()`,得到结果1。将此公式向右拖动填充至D1,B1、C1、D1将分别自动得到结果2、3、4。这比手动输入数字序列高效且不易出错,尤其适用于作为其他函数的索引参数,例如与索引函数结合进行动态数据查询。

       四、 处理范围:返回首个列号

       当COLUMN函数的参数不是一个单一单元格,而是一个单元格区域时,它的行为值得特别注意。根据官方文档说明,该函数将只返回该区域最左侧列的列号。例如,公式`=COLUMN(B2:D5)`,虽然参数涵盖了B、C、D三列,但函数仅返回区域起始列B的列号,即数字2。理解这一点对于避免在复杂公式中产生预期外的结果至关重要。

       五、 孪生伙伴:ROW函数的横向对照

       有列自然有行。ROW函数是COLUMN函数在垂直方向上的完美对照,它返回指定单元格的行号。这两个函数经常成对使用,以构建二维的坐标引用。例如,结合使用`=ADDRESS(ROW(), COLUMN())`可以动态地返回当前单元格的绝对地址引用。理解这对函数的协同工作,是掌握单元格位置编程化引用的关键一步。

       六、 扩展家族:COLUMNS函数的范围统计

       请注意COLUMNS(带S)与COLUMN函数的区别。COLUMNS函数用于统计一个给定区域或数组包含多少列。其语法为`=COLUMNS(array)`。例如,`=COLUMNS(A1:F1)`返回6,因为区域横跨了A到F共6列;`=COLUMNS(1,2,3;4,5,6)`返回3,因为这个常量数组有3列。它在需要动态判断数据表宽度时非常有用,例如与偏移量函数配合创建动态范围。

       七、 实战场景一:创建动态序列与编号

       这是COLUMN函数最直接的应用。在制作表格标题、项目编号,或任何需要连续数字序列的场景中,都可以使用它。假设我们需要在第一行生成从1开始的月份标题,可以在A1单元格输入公式`=COLUMN()`,然后向右填充。这样,无论表格如何增减列,序列都能自动适应,无需手动修改每个单元格的数字。

       八、 实战场景二:作为查找函数的索引参数

       在与查找类函数结合时,COLUMN函数能发挥巨大威力。例如,在使用索引函数和匹配函数进行交叉查询时,我们经常需要指定返回哪一列的数据。通过`=INDEX(数据区域, MATCH(行条件, 条件列, 0), COLUMN()-X)`这样的结构,其中X是一个固定偏移值,可以实现当公式横向拖动时,自动从数据区域中依次返回不同列的结果,从而实现一次性查询并返回整行数据。

       九、 实战场景三:实现公式的横向复制填充

       许多复杂的计算需要随列变化参数。例如,计算各季度占全年总额的百分比,分母(全年总额)是固定的,但分子(各季度值)随列变化。我们可以设置公式为`=B2/$F2`,然后向右填充。但更通用的方法是利用COLUMN函数构建引用:`=INDEX($B2:$E2, COLUMN()-1)/$F2`。这样即使季度数据的起始列改变,公式逻辑也无需重写,只需调整偏移量即可。

       十、 与数组常量的结合应用

       在动态数组公式中,COLUMN函数可以用来生成序列数组。例如,公式`=SEQUENCE(1,5)`可以生成一行五列的水平序列1,2,3,4,5。而在不支持新函数的旧版本中,可以通过`=COLUMN(A1:E1)-COLUMN(A1)+1`这样的数组公式(按Ctrl+Shift+Enter输入)实现类似效果。这展示了如何利用基础函数构建数组运算的逻辑。

       十一、 进阶技巧:构建多维引用与计算

       对于高级用户,COLUMN函数可以参与到更复杂的多维计算中。例如,结合间接函数和地址函数,可以根据当前列号动态构建对其他工作表或工作簿的引用。再比如,在模拟规划求解或进行矩阵运算时,列序号可以作为关键的坐标变量,参与到数学模型中,实现数据位置的参数化计算。

       十二、 常见误区与错误排查

       在使用过程中,有几个常见错误需要警惕。首先是混淆COLUMN与COLUMNS,前者返回位置,后者返回数量。其次,当参数为合并单元格时,COLUMN函数返回的是合并区域左上角单元格的列号。再者,如果参数引用了一个已删除的列,函数将返回错误值。理解这些边界情况,有助于在公式出错时快速定位问题根源。

       十三、 性能考量与最佳实践

       虽然COLUMN函数本身计算开销很小,但在大型工作簿或复杂数组公式中大量使用时,仍需注意性能。避免在整列引用中嵌套使用(如`=COLUMN(A:A)`),这可能导致不必要的全列计算。尽量将引用范围限制在明确的数据区域。同时,清晰的公式注释和结构化的布局,能让基于列引用的动态模型更易于维护。

       十四、 视觉交互:列与表格格式的关联

       “列”的概念也深刻影响着表格的视觉呈现。条件格式、数据验证、列宽调整等操作,都是以列为单位进行的。例如,我们可以设置基于整列的规则,当该列任一单元格的值超过阈值时高亮显示。理解列作为格式应用的整体单元,能让我们更高效地设计美观且实用的数据表格。

       十五、 从列到结构化引用:表格功能的升华

       在将普通区域转换为“表格”后,软件引入了更强大的结构化引用。此时,我们可以直接使用列标题名来引用整列数据,例如`=SUM(表1[销售额])`。这种引用方式直观且不易因插入删除列而断裂。虽然形式上不再直接使用COL函数,但其本质仍是基于“列”的逻辑进行数据组织,代表了列引用更高级、更易读的形态。

       十六、 历史沿革与版本差异

       COLUMN函数自早期版本就已存在,其核心行为保持稳定。但随着软件迭代,与之配合的生态系统发生了巨大变化。例如,动态数组函数的出现(如SEQUENCE)提供了生成序列的新方法;新的引用函数使得某些以往需要COLUMN函数实现的技巧变得更为简洁。了解这些演进,有助于我们根据所使用的软件版本选择最优雅高效的解决方案。

       十七、 总结:COL是数据思维的坐标轴

       归根结底,掌握“COL”的精髓,不仅仅是学会一个函数或记住一个概念。它是将表格空间坐标化、参数化的一种思维方式。通过COLUMN及其相关函数,我们让公式具备了“位置感”,能够根据所处的列自动调整行为,从而构建出灵活、健壮且自动化的工作表模型。这标志着从手动操作数据到程序化驱动数据的思维跃迁。

       十八、 延伸思考:超越单个工作表的列管理

       最后,我们的视野可以放得更广。在涉及多个工作表或工作簿的数据整合项目中,“列”的一致性至关重要。确保不同来源的同一数据属性位于相同的列索引,是使用查询工具进行高效合并的前提。因此,在设计数据模板和制定数据规范时,就必须将“列”的结构作为核心要素来考量,这能从根本上提升数据生态系统的质量和处理效率。

       希望这篇详尽的解析,能帮助您彻底理解表格处理软件中“COL”的意义,并将这些知识转化为解决实际问题的能力。从基础的单元格定位到构建复杂的动态报表,对“列”的深刻理解都是您高效驾驭数据之旅中不可或缺的基石。

       

相关文章
在word中正确文章格式是什么
在文字处理软件中掌握正确的文章格式,是提升文档专业性与可读性的关键。本文将系统阐述从页面布局、字体段落设置,到样式应用、目录生成等十二个核心要点,结合官方操作指南,帮助您构建既符合规范又清晰美观的文档结构,显著提升写作与排版效率。
2026-04-13 23:23:54
306人看过
bootloader有什么作用是什么意思
在计算机系统启动过程中,有一个关键但常被忽视的组件扮演着“幕后英雄”的角色,它就是引导加载程序。简单来说,它是设备上电后运行的第一段软件,负责初始化硬件、加载并启动操作系统内核,是连接硬件固件与复杂操作系统的桥梁。理解其作用与意义,对于深入了解计算机启动原理、进行系统维护乃至嵌入式开发都至关重要。
2026-04-13 23:23:52
365人看过
1t流量多少钱
在数字化时代,数据流量已成为生活与工作的必需品。本文将深度探讨购买1TB(太字节)流量在不同场景下的成本构成。内容涵盖个人移动网络、家庭宽带、企业专线及云服务等多个维度,分析影响价格的关键因素,如技术类型、地域差异、运营商策略及附加服务。通过对比国内外资费与解析计费模式,旨在为您提供一份全面、实用的参考指南,助您做出更经济的流量消费决策。
2026-04-13 23:23:30
88人看过
如何调节lcd亮度
在当今数字时代,液晶显示器(LCD)已成为我们工作与娱乐的核心界面。屏幕亮度的调节不仅关乎视觉舒适度,更与设备续航、显示效果乃至眼部健康息息相关。本文将深入探讨调节LCD亮度的多种方法、其背后的技术原理以及最佳实践指南,旨在帮助您根据不同的使用场景和环境光线,科学、精准地掌控屏幕亮度,从而获得更佳的视觉体验并有效保护视力。
2026-04-13 23:23:22
70人看过
如何删除显卡设置
显卡设置的删除操作涉及驱动程序卸载、注册表清理与系统恢复等多个层面,本文将从备份准备、安全模式操作、专用工具使用到后续优化等十二个核心环节,系统解析如何在英伟达、超微半导体及英特尔等主流显卡环境中彻底移除配置,并提供故障应对与长期维护方案,确保用户能安全高效地完成显卡设置重置。
2026-04-13 23:23:13
344人看过
word中为什么不能组合照片
本文深入探讨了在微软文字处理软件中,用户常遇到的无法将多张图片组合成一个单一对象的问题。文章从软件的核心设计理念、功能定位、底层技术架构以及图像处理逻辑等多个维度,进行了系统性剖析。我们将揭示这一限制背后的深层原因,并为您提供一系列经过验证的有效解决方案和替代工作流程,帮助您高效完成文档中的图像编排任务。
2026-04-13 23:23:06
110人看过